Grant Park is one of Atlanta's oldest neighborhoods, and the corner of Atlanta Avenue and United Avenue carries a new kind of weight - the street used to be named Confederate. The rename happened recently enough that some locals still do a double-take at the sign. For Atlanta United fans, the intersection reads as something else entirely. The Atlanta Beltline is 22 miles of trail, greenway, and public art looping through 45 neighborhoods — a former rail corridor that became one of the most ambitious urban redevelopment projects in the country and, this year, turns 20. Atlanta-Fulton County Stadium is where Hank Aaron stepped up to the plate on April 8, 1974, and sent a fastball over the left-center wall for home run 715, breaking a record that had stood for decades in front of a roaring home crowd. This tee captures that layered history, a stadium that hosted Braves games, Falcons Sundays, and stadium-shaking concerts before closing its gates in 1996 to make way for Turner Field.
